2. You’ve Been in a Car Accident

What it means:
Even minor fender-benders can cause hidden injuries like whiplash, back pain, or joint misalignments — symptoms that might not appear right away.What you can do:
  • Seek medical attention immediately, even if you feel fine

  • Watch for delayed symptoms such as headaches, neck stiffness, dizziness, or pain

  • Keep a record of your symptoms and any medical visits

3. Frequent Headaches or Migraines

What it means:
Headaches can be triggered by tension, neck misalignments, dehydration, or stress. What you can do:
  • Stay hydrated and manage stress

  • Take regular breaks from screens

  • Track your headache triggers

  • If headaches are frequent or severe, see a chiropractor

5. Numbness or Tingling

What it means:
Numbness, tingling, or weakness in your arms or legs may signal nerve compression, often caused by spinal misalignments or herniated discs. What you can do:
  • Avoid activities that make symptoms worse

  • Track when and where numbness occurs

  • Seek prompt evaluation if symptoms persist
